Replace Pool Pump in Washington, District of Columbia typically costs $1,006 to $1,230 as of 2026. Prices reflect local labor and material rates. Use our calculator below for a detailed, ZIP-code-adjusted estimate.
Replace Pool Pump in Washington, District of Columbia
$1,006 – $1,230
Prices in Washington are 23.0% higher than the national average for replace pool pump.
National average: $818 – $1,000
Cost Breakdown in Washington
| Component | Category | Price Range | Unit |
|---|---|---|---|
| Materials | material | $442 – $540 | job |
| Labor | labor | $358 – $438 | job |
| Supplies & Other | supplies | $118 – $144 | job |
| Equipment & Disposal | equipment | $79 – $96 | job |
Prices adjusted for Washington local market conditions.
